Best time to go

The best time to visit Raebareli is during the winter months (October to March) when the weather is pleasant. However, you can visit Raebareli at any time of the year.

What to Eat

Raebareli is known for its delicious Awadhi cuisine. Some of the must-try dishes include:

  • Biryani: A fragrant rice dish cooked with meat, vegetables, and spices.
  • Kebabs: Grilled meat marinated in yogurt and spices.
  • Korma: A creamy curry made with meat or vegetables.
  • Chaat: A savory snack made with fried dough, chickpeas, and spices.
  • Samosas: Fried pastries filled with vegetables or meat.
